Kenyans Jepchirchir, Chebet win Boston Marathon titles
Chebet won in two hours, six minutes and 51 seconds to top the first all-Kenyan podium since 2012, beating 2019 Boston winner Lawrence Cherono by 30 seconds with defending champion Benson Kipruto third in 2:07:27. "I'm extremely proud," Chebet said through a translator. "I knew I had it in my legs to win." Jepchirchir, last year's New York Marathon champion, won her Boston debut by edging Ethiopia's Ababel Yeshaneh in the final strides, taking her fifth victory in a row since 2019 in 2:21:01.
